Schoen Books Reprint. A translation of Lazare's important historical socio-political study of the Jews in Romania.88 pp. reprint. Perfect-bound. New. Lazare (1865-1903), "first of the Dreyfusards", was an anarchist and literary critic who fought for Dreyfus. Wrote Job's Dungheap: Antisemitism Its History and Cause, a major influence on Hannah Arendt, which called for total assimilation. Experience in the Dreyfus Affair led to his defense of oppressed Jews. Founded the Zionist magazine Le Flambeau. $15.00.
